6. Text labels<br />

<strong>think</strong>-<strong>cell</strong> takes care of correct and readable labeling.<br />

Avoid using PowerPoint text boxes to label your charts<br />

as they will be ignored by <strong>think</strong>-<strong>cell</strong>’s automatic label<br />

placement. When you create labels from <strong>think</strong>-<strong>cell</strong>’s<br />

context menu, the default content is taken from the data<br />

sheet or calculated by the program (in the case of column<br />

totals, averages, and alike).<br />

In addition, you can always enter additional text or replace<br />

the default text inside <strong>think</strong>-<strong>cell</strong>’s automatic labels.<br />

When a label is selected, you can start typing, overwriting<br />

the current text. If you want to keep the existing text,<br />

enter text editing mode by pressing ✄ ✂ F2✁and use the cursor<br />

keys and ✄ <br />

✂Home/<br />

✁<br />

✄ <br />

✂End✁keys<br />

to navigate within the label<br />

text. This section explains how <strong>think</strong>-<strong>cell</strong>’s labels work in<br />

detail.<br />
